1. Shopify’s Built-In Email Marketing: Convenience and Seamless Integration
Shopify’s built-in email marketing tool, Shopify Email, is tailored specifically for Shopify stores, making it easy for new users to navigate. Here are some of the key benefits:
Seamless Integration
Shopify Email is built into the Shopify platform, making it easy to set up without needing a separate integration. Simple Setup and Ease of Use
Shopify Email’s intuitive interface makes it ideal for beginners. If you’ve taken a Shopify course or are familiar with Shopify’s basic tools, you’ll find Shopify Email straightforward. You can customize email templates with your store branding, logos, and color schemes with minimal technical knowledge.

Access to Shopify Customer Data
One of the best features of Shopify Email is its direct access to Shopify’s customer data, allowing for accurate audience targeting. 2. Third-Party Email Marketing Tools: More Customization and Advanced Features
While Shopify’s built-in email marketing is highly effective, some users may want more advanced features that third-party tools offer. Here are some benefits:
Advanced Automation and Customization
Third-party email marketing tools, like Mailchimp, Klaviyo, and ActiveCampaign, offer advanced automation workflows, enabling you to set up sophisticated campaigns like abandoned cart reminders, win-back sequences, and welcome emails. Detailed Audience Segmentation
Advanced segmentation options in third-party tools let you create highly specific customer lists based on complex criteria. For example, you can target high-value customers, repeat buyers, or subscribers interested in certain product categories. Integrations Beyond Shopify
Many third-party email tools offer integrations with platforms outside of Shopify, such as Facebook, Google, and CRM tools. 4. Combining Shopify Email and Third-Party Tools
While it may seem like a choice between the two, many successful stores use both Shopify Email and third-party tools strategically. For example, you might use Shopify Email for simpler campaigns like product announcements or seasonal greetings and a third-party tool for more targeted campaigns.
